there are some points that should be highlighted below and those points will be helpful while creating awareness about COVID-19.

1. wash your hands often with soap and water for at least 20 seconds. use alcohol-based hand sanitizer that contains at least 60% alcohol if soap and water are not available.

2. fully cover torso from neck to knees, arms to the end of wrists, and wrap around the back.

3. fit flexible mask band to the nose bridge.

4. use a face shield and cover over the face.

5. use gloves to cover the wrist and throw it in the dustbin after using it.

6. keep hands away from the face.

7. maintain social distance.

8. always eat hygienically and home food.

• Avoid touching surfaces, especially in public settings or health facilities, in case people infected with COVID-19 have touched them. Clean surfaces regularly with standard disinfectants. 

• Frequently clean your hands with soap and water, or an alcohol-based hand rub.

Sedentary behaviour and low levels of physical activity can have negative effects on the health, well-being and quality of life of individuals. Self-quarantine can also cause additional stress and challenge the mental health of citizens. Physical activity and relaxation techniques can be valuable tools to help you remain calm and continue to protect your health during this time. WHO recommends 150 minutes of moderate-intensity or 75 minutes of vigorous-intensity physical activity per week, or a combination of both.

There are several ways to help raise awareness about COVID-19:

Share information: Share accurate information about COVID-19 and its symptoms with your family, friends, and community through social media, email, or other means.

Follow guidelines: Follow guidelines and protocols set by health authorities such as wearing a mask, practicing social distancing, and washing your hands frequently.

Support healthcare workers: Show your support for healthcare workers who are on the front lines by sharing their stories and expressing your gratitude.

Donate: Consider donating to organizations that are working to fight COVID-19, such as those providing medical supplies, testing kits, and vaccines.

Be a role model: Model responsible behavior in your own actions, such as wearing a mask, practicing social distancing, and avoiding large gatherings.

Get vaccinated: Get vaccinated when it becomes available to you and encourage others to do the same.

Advocate: Advocate for policies and actions that prioritize public health and safety, such as increased funding for healthcare and research, as well as support for those affected by the pandemic

There are several ways to help raise awareness about COVID-19:

1. Share accurate information: Share reliable information from reputable sources such as the World Health Organization (WHO),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), or local health authorities.

2. Promote preventive measures: Encourage others to follow preventive measures such as wearing masks, practicing good hand hygiene, maintaining physical distance, and getting vaccinated when eligible.

3. Combat misinformation: Be vigilant about misinformation and actively work to debunk myths and rumors about COVID-19.

4. Support public health efforts: Participate in public health campaigns and initiatives aimed at raising awareness and promoting vaccination.

5. Lead by example: Practice safe behaviors yourself and encourage others to do the same.

6. Engage with your community: Organize or participate in community events, webinars, or discussions focused on COVID-19 awareness and prevention.

By taking these actions, individuals can contribute to the collective effort to combat COVID-19 and keep communities safe and informed.
